Americares Junior Council is a group of young professionals who act year-round as ambassadors for Americares important work. The group, led by Chair, Tim Bosek, meets quarterly to discuss innovative ways to engage a younger generation of philanthropists through events, Social Media campaigns and volunteer activities.
